It's Not About Doing More Kegels

Why Generic Care Fails You

  • Kegel-only protocols assume a weak pelvic floor — but many women actually have an overactive or hypertonic pelvic floor that needs to relax, not strengthen
  • OB-GYNs rarely have time to assess pelvic floor mechanics — a 10-minute appointment doesn't reveal what's actually happening with your muscles and tissue
  • Generic "core exercises" don't address the specific dysfunction driving your symptoms — and can sometimes make them worse
  • "Just do yoga and lose weight" — advice that ignores the real mechanical cause entirely

How You Finally Get Answers

  • Specialized Pelvic Floor Assessment — a full internal and external evaluation to identify exactly what your muscles are doing (or not doing)
  • Manual Therapy Techniques — hands-on treatment to restore proper tissue mobility, reduce tension, and address scar tissue from childbirth or surgery
  • Functional Movement Retraining — building pressure management, breathing mechanics, and load tolerance so you can run, lift, and move without fear
  • Individualized, Not Cookie-Cutter — every plan is built around your body, your history, and your specific goals
